What is an algorithm? What are the characteristics of a good algorithm?
An algorithm is "a step-by-step process for accomplishing some task'' An algorithm can be given in many ways. For example, it can be written down in English (or French, or any other ''natural'' language). Though, we are interested in algorithms which have been precisely specified using an appropriate mathematical formalism--like as a programming language.
Each algorithm should have the following three characteristics:
1. Input: The algorithm should take zero or more input.
2. Output: The algorithm should produce one or more outputs.
3. Definiteness: Each and every step of algorithm should be described unambiguously.
